This is an agreement between an employer and a draftsman whereby the employer hires the draftsman as an independent contractor. Please note that this Agreement is intended for general use. Your state law may require that additional or different provisions be included for agreements between a homeowner and a contractor for work on the home. In this instance, please consult your local law, local government or legal counsel. Self-Employed: Relates to individuals who work for themselves and are not considered employees of the company or client they provide services to. Self-employed individuals have control over their work and business decisions. 4. Independent Contractor: Refers to someone who provides services to clients or companies on a freelance basis. Independent contractors are not employees and are usually engaged for a specific project or set of tasks, rather than long-term employment.
